WARNING

If you do not follow these instructions

exactly, a fire or explosion may result

causing property damage, personal injury

or loss of life.

• This appliance is equipped with an ignition device

which automatically lights burner. Do NOT try to

light this burner by hand.

• Before operating smell all around appliance area

for gas. Be sure to smell next to floor because

some gas is heavier than air and will settle to the

floor.

• Use only your hand to turn the gas shutoff

valve. Never use tools. If valve will not turn

by hand, do not try to repair it, call a qualified

service technician. Force or attempted repair may

result in fire or explosion.

• Do not use this appliance if any part has

been under water. Immediately call a qualified

service technician to inspect appliance and to

replace any part of control system and any gas

control which has been under water.

CAUTION

WHAT TO DO IF YOU SMELL GAS

• Do not try to light any appliance.
• Do not touch any electrical switches; do not use

any phone in your building.

• Immediately call your gas supplier from a

neighbor’s phone. Follow the gas supplier’s

instructions.

• If you cannot reach your gas supplier, call the fire

department.

11 - STARTUP

Operating Instructions

1.

STOP! Read the safety information on this page before

operating this appliance.

2.

Set the thermostat to the lowest setting.

3.

Turn off all electrical power to the appliance.

4.

This appliance does not have a pilot. It is equipped with

an ignition device which automatically lights the burner.

Do NOT try to light this burner by hand.

5.

Remove the front jacket panel.

6.

Turn off the gas shut off valve. Valve handle should be

perpendicular to the gas pipe.

7.

Wait five minutes for any gas to clear. Then smell for

gas, including near the floor. If you smell gas, STOP!

Follow instructions at left under “What To Do If You

Smell Gas.” If you do not smell gas, go to the next

step.

8.

Turn the gas shut off valve to the “On” position. The

handle on the valve should be parallel to the gas pipe.

9.

Replace the front jacket panel.

10.

Turn on all electrical power to the appliance.

11.

Set thermostat to desired setting.

12.

If the appliance will not operate, follow instructions in

“To Turn Off Gas To Appliance” (below) and call

your service technician or gas supplier.

To Turn Off Gas To Appliance

1.

Set thermostat to lowest setting.

2.

Turn off all electric power to appliance if service is to be

performed.

3.

Remove the front jacket panel.

4.

Turn gas shut off valve off. Handle should be

perpendicular to the gas pipe.

5.

Replace the front jacket panel.
